It’s also vital to understand that accessibility is distinct from usability, though they are closely related and often mutually reinforcing. Usability focuses on making a product efficient, effective, and satisfying for all users. Accessibility, however, specifically addresses the needs of users with disabilities. While a highly usable product might still be inaccessible to someone with a visual impairment, an accessible product is inherently designed with a broader range of user needs in mind, which often leads to a more usable experience for everyone. Think of it this way: usability is about making a door easy to open; accessibility is about ensuring that door can be opened by someone using a wheelchair, or someone with limited hand dexterity, or someone who can’t see the handle.

Perceivable: Seeing, Hearing, and Feeling the Experience

This principle is all about ensuring that your users can actually take in the information and interact with your interface, regardless of their sensory abilities. It’s not enough to have content; it must be delivered in a way that can be sensed. This means providing text alternatives for non-text content (think alt text for images), captions and transcripts for audio and video, and ensuring sufficient color contrast so that text and important graphical elements stand out. Creativity here lies in finding innovative ways to represent information – perhaps haptic feedback for crucial alerts, or dynamic audio cues that adapt to user preferences.

Operable: Effortless Interaction for Everyone

Can users navigate and interact with your product easily? This is the core of operability. It encompasses keyboard accessibility, ensuring that every function can be accessed without a mouse. It means providing enough time for users to read and use content, avoiding flashing content that can trigger seizures, and designing clear and intuitive navigation. Innovation thrives when we consider diverse input methods – voice commands, gesture controls, or even eye-tracking – making your product a playground for interaction, not a hurdle.

Understandable: Clarity in Information and Operation

A product that is difficult to understand is a product that alienates. This principle focuses on making both the information presented and the operation of your interface clear and straightforward. This involves using plain language, ensuring consistent navigation and identification of elements, and providing clear instructions and error messages. Think about how you can simplify complex processes, offer contextual help, and design interfaces that are predictable and learnable. Creative problem-solving is paramount here, turning potentially confusing experiences into delightful and empowering ones.

Robust: Future-Proofing Your Innovation

This is where we build for longevity and adaptability. Robustness ensures that your product can be reliably interpreted by a wide range of user agents, crucially including assistive technologies like screen readers. This means adhering to established web standards and guidelines, using semantic HTML, and testing rigorously with various devices and accessibility tools. The creative aspect here is in building a flexible foundation that can evolve with new technologies and user needs, ensuring your innovation remains relevant and accessible for years to come.

For users with visual impairments, the digital world can present significant barriers. Achieving sufficient contrast between text and background is paramount, ensuring legibility for those with low vision or light sensitivity. Beyond simple contrast, understanding and designing for color blindness is crucial; relying solely on color to convey information can render features inaccessible. This is where creative solutions like incorporating patterns, icons, or labels alongside color becomes essential.

Furthermore, screen reader compatibility is non-negotiable. Properly structured HTML, descriptive alt text for images, and semantic markup allow assistive technologies to interpret and convey content accurately. Equally important is supporting font scaling. Users should be able to adjust text size to their comfort level without breaking the layout or losing critical information. This requires flexible design that adapts gracefully to different text dimensions.

Amplifying Sound and Visual Cues

Auditory impairments necessitate a multi-modal approach to information delivery. Captions for video and audio content are a basic but vital requirement, ensuring that spoken dialogue and key sound effects are accessible to deaf and hard-of-hearing users. Where full captions are not feasible, transcripts provide a text-based alternative for understanding spoken content. Critically, we must also consider visual alternatives for auditory cues. Flashing lights or visual notifications can be equally effective as sound alerts for system status or incoming messages.

Empowering Movement and Interaction

For users with motor impairments, the way we design for interaction is key. Keyboard navigation must be seamless and intuitive, allowing users to access all interactive elements using only a keyboard. This means ensuring logical tab order and visible focus indicators. Sufficient target sizes for buttons and interactive elements are also vital; small, tightly packed targets can be frustrating or impossible to hit accurately with a mouse or other input devices.

Crucially, we must avoid time-based interactions where possible, or provide generous time extensions. Users who rely on keyboard navigation or have slower reaction times can be excluded by features that require rapid responses. Offering the ability to pause, extend, or disable timed elements fosters a more equitable experience.

Fostering Clarity and Predictability

Cognitive and learning disabilities demand a focus on clear language, avoiding jargon and complex sentence structures. Consistent navigation across the entire product is essential, so users can build a mental model of how to move through the interface. This predictability reduces cognitive load and allows users to focus on their goals.

Predictable interfaces mean that elements behave as expected, and users can anticipate the outcome of their actions. This builds confidence and reduces anxiety. Equally important is robust error prevention and recovery. Designing in ways that guide users away from making mistakes, and providing clear, actionable feedback when errors do occur, is a cornerstone of good design. This might involve confirmation dialogues for critical actions or helpful inline validation for form fields.

Crafting the Visual Language of Inclusion: The Design Phase

The design phase is where your product’s aesthetic truly comes to life. But a beautiful product isn’t necessarily an accessible one. Accessibility needs to be embedded in your design system.

  • Color Contrast: Adhere to WCAG (Web Content Accessibility Guidelines) contrast ratios for text and interactive elements. Tools like contrast checkers are invaluable here.
  • Typography: Choose legible fonts and ensure font sizes are adjustable. Provide clear line spacing and paragraph breaks.
  • Component Libraries: Build your component libraries with accessibility baked in. Each button, form field, and modal should have accessible states and behaviors defined. This ensures consistency and reduces the burden on individual developers.
  • Meaningful Visual Cues: Don’t rely solely on color to convey information. Use icons, patterns, and text labels to reinforce meaning for users with color vision deficiencies.

Building for Everyone: The Development Phase

This is where the rubber meets the road. Developers are the architects of the user experience, and their understanding of accessibility principles is paramount.

  • Semantic HTML: Use HTML elements for their intended purpose (e.g., <nav>, <button>, <main>). This provides inherent structure and meaning for assistive technologies.
  • ARIA Attributes: Leverage Accessible Rich Internet Applications (ARIA) attributes judiciously to enhance the accessibility of dynamic content and custom controls. However, remember that native HTML is often sufficient and preferred.
  • Keyboard Navigability: Ensure all interactive elements are fully operable via keyboard alone. Pay close attention to focus management and logical tab order.
  • Responsive Design: Accessibility is inherently linked to responsiveness. A product that adapts to different screen sizes and orientations should also adapt to different user needs.

The Crucible of Validation: Testing and QA

The final, crucial step is rigorous testing. Accessibility isn’t a feature that can be assumed; it must be verified.

  • Automated Tools: Utilize automated accessibility checkers (like Lighthouse, axe, or WAVE) to catch common issues early. These are excellent for initial scans but are not a substitute for human evaluation.
  • Manual Testing: Conduct thorough manual testing, especially with keyboard-only navigation and screen readers (e.g., NVDA, JAWS, VoiceOver).
  • User Testing with People with Disabilities: This is non-negotiable. Involve individuals with a range of disabilities in your testing cycles. Their lived experiences and feedback are invaluable for identifying subtle barriers and uncovering innovative solutions you might have overlooked. This is where true creative refinement happens.

Understanding the Power of Assistive Technologies

At its core, assistive technology (AT) is about enabling individuals with diverse needs to interact with the digital world. Ignoring these tools is like building a spectacular stage but neglecting the ramps and lifts that allow everyone to reach the front row. Familiarize yourself with some of the most prevalent:

  • Screen Readers: These are the voices of the web for visually impaired users, converting text and interface elements into synthesized speech or Braille output. Understanding how they interpret your content is paramount.
  • Screen Magnifiers: For users with low vision, magnifiers enlarge portions of the screen, making small text and intricate details legible. Your design must remain functional and aesthetically pleasing even when scaled up dramatically.
  • Voice Control Software: This technology allows users to navigate and interact with devices using spoken commands. Think of it as a hands-free interface, where clear, logical design translates directly into intuitive control.

To illustrate the critical standards that underpin our efforts, consider this:

Standard Focus Key Takeaway
WCAG (Web Content Accessibility Guidelines) Broad web accessibility, covering a wide range of disabilities. Think POUR: Perceivable, Operable, Understandable, Robust.
Section 508 US federal accessibility standard for IT. Ensures federal agencies procure and use accessible technology.
EN 301 549 European accessibility standard for ICT products and services. Harmonizes accessibility requirements across the EU.

Forging Your Accessibility Compass: Establishing Key Performance Indicators (KPIs)

To improve, we must first understand where we stand. Accessibility KPIs aren’t just about ticking boxes; they’re about quantifying the impact of our design choices and identifying areas ripe for creative intervention. Think beyond simple compliance. Consider metrics like:

  • User Success Rates: How effectively do users with different needs complete key tasks within your product? This is your ultimate litmus test.
  • Assistive Technology Compatibility: Track the percentage of users successfully navigating your product with screen readers, keyboard-only navigation, voice control, and other assistive technologies.
  • Time-on-Task for Diverse Users: Is the time it takes for users with disabilities to complete tasks comparable to their non-disabled counterparts?
  • Error Rates for Users with Disabilities: Are specific design elements disproportionately causing errors for certain user groups?
  • Accessibility Scorecard: Develop an internal scoring system that aggregates compliance with various accessibility guidelines (WCAG, etc.), user feedback, and testing results.

These KPIs will act as your north star, guiding your efforts and demonstrating tangible progress to your team and stakeholders.

The Perpetual Vigil: Ongoing Monitoring and Regular Audits

Accessibility isn’t a one-and-done checkbox; it’s an ongoing journey. Think of it like maintaining a vibrant garden – consistent care yields beautiful results. Implement a robust system for continuous monitoring:

  • Automated Accessibility Scans: Integrate tools into your CI/CD pipeline to catch common accessibility violations early and often.
  • Manual Accessibility Testing: Regular, in-depth testing by accessibility experts and, crucially, by individuals with diverse disabilities, is indispensable. This goes beyond automated checks to uncover nuanced issues.
  • Usability Testing with Diverse Participants: Actively recruit individuals with a wide range of disabilities to participate in your regular usability studies. Their lived experiences are invaluable.
  • Post-Launch Monitoring: Keep a close eye on user feedback channels, support tickets, and social media for any reported accessibility issues.

These ongoing efforts ensure that as your product evolves, its accessibility remains strong, preventing the slow creep of exclusion.
